TCI - Update next target
* update jacoco-version to be compatible with Java 17
Change-Id: I1d89a90340bef3f63015386083af261f9e138f70
Signed-off-by: Johannes Faltermeier <jfaltermeier@eclipsesource.com>
diff --git a/releng/org.eclipse.emf.ecp.releng.tests/pom.xml b/releng/org.eclipse.emf.ecp.releng.tests/pom.xml
index fb0bcd0..4661e8d 100644
--- a/releng/org.eclipse.emf.ecp.releng.tests/pom.xml
+++ b/releng/org.eclipse.emf.ecp.releng.tests/pom.xml
@@ -16,7 +16,7 @@
<properties>
- <baseTestArgLine></baseTestArgLine>
+ <baseTestArgLine>--add-opens java.base/java.lang=ALL-UNNAMED</baseTestArgLine>
</properties>
<profiles>
@@ -28,7 +28,7 @@
</os>
</activation>
<properties>
- <baseTestArgLine>-XstartOnFirstThread</baseTestArgLine>
+ <baseTestArgLine>--add-opens java.base/java.lang=ALL-UNNAMED -XstartOnFirstThread</baseTestArgLine>
</properties>
</profile>
<profile>
diff --git a/releng/org.eclipse.emf.ecp.releng/pom.xml b/releng/org.eclipse.emf.ecp.releng/pom.xml
index 91465d0..4b35c61 100644
--- a/releng/org.eclipse.emf.ecp.releng/pom.xml
+++ b/releng/org.eclipse.emf.ecp.releng/pom.xml
@@ -22,7 +22,7 @@
<junit-version>4.12</junit-version>
<mav-checkstyle-version>3.1.1</mav-checkstyle-version>
<checkstyle-version>8.8</checkstyle-version>
- <jacoco-version>0.8.5</jacoco-version>
+ <jacoco-version>0.8.10</jacoco-version>
<jacoco.percentage.instruction>0.5</jacoco.percentage.instruction>
<!-- Properties to enable jacoco code coverage analysis with sonar -->
diff --git a/releng/org.eclipse.emf.ecp.target.next/next.target b/releng/org.eclipse.emf.ecp.target.next/next.target
index bd880d3..03503f3 100644
--- a/releng/org.eclipse.emf.ecp.target.next/next.target
+++ b/releng/org.eclipse.emf.ecp.target.next/next.target
@@ -1,7 +1,7 @@
<?xml version="1.0" encoding="UTF-8" standalone="no"?>
<?pde?>
<!-- generated with https://github.com/eclipse-cbi/targetplatform-dsl -->
-<target name="ECP RCP" sequenceNumber="1685444500">
+<target name="ECP RCP" sequenceNumber="1685623988">
<locations>
<location includeMode="slicer" includeAllPlatforms="false" includeSource="true" includeConfigurePhase="true" type="InstallableUnit">
<unit id="org.eclipse.swtbot.eclipse.feature.group" version="0.0.0"/>
@@ -54,6 +54,10 @@
<unit id="org.apache.commons.io.source" version="0.0.0"/>
<unit id="org.slf4j.api" version="0.0.0"/>
<unit id="org.slf4j.api.source" version="0.0.0"/>
+ <unit id="javax.annotation" version="0.0.0"/>
+ <unit id="javax.annotation.source" version="0.0.0"/>
+ <unit id="javax.inject" version="0.0.0"/>
+ <unit id="javax.inject.source" version="0.0.0"/>
<repository location="https://download.eclipse.org/tools/orbit/downloads/drops/R20220830213456/repository/"/>
</location>
<location includeMode="slicer" includeAllPlatforms="false" includeSource="true" includeConfigurePhase="true" type="InstallableUnit">
diff --git a/releng/org.eclipse.emf.ecp.target.next/next.tpd b/releng/org.eclipse.emf.ecp.target.next/next.tpd
index d18f51c..bb9acec 100644
--- a/releng/org.eclipse.emf.ecp.target.next/next.tpd
+++ b/releng/org.eclipse.emf.ecp.target.next/next.tpd
@@ -53,6 +53,10 @@
org.apache.commons.io.source lazy
org.slf4j.api lazy
org.slf4j.api.source lazy
+ javax.annotation lazy
+ javax.annotation.source lazy
+ javax.inject lazy
+ javax.inject.source lazy
}
location "https://download.eclipse.org/tools/orbit/downloads/drops/R20220302172233/repository" {
diff --git a/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ng.tests/pom.xml b/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ng.tests/pom.xml
index dc7feec..ab91158 100644
--- a/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ng.tests/pom.xml
+++ b/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ng.tests/pom.xml
@@ -15,7 +15,7 @@
<packaging>pom</packaging>
<properties>
- <baseTestArgLine></baseTestArgLine>
+ <baseTestArgLine>--add-opens java.base/java.lang=ALL-UNNAMED</baseTestArgLine>
</properties>
<profiles>
diff --git a/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ng/pom.xml b/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ng/pom.xml
index a140019..a8b7a0a 100644
--- a/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ng/pom.xml
+++ b/releng/spreadsheet/org.eclipse.emfforms.spreadsheet.releng/pom.xml
@@ -20,7 +20,7 @@
<mav-surefire-version>2.22.2</mav-surefire-version>
<junit-version>4.12</junit-version>
<checkstyle-version>8.5</checkstyle-version>
- <jacoco-version>0.8.5</jacoco-version>
+ <jacoco-version>0.8.10</jacoco-version>
<!-- Properties to enable jacoco code coverage analysis with sonar -->
<sonar.core.codeCoveragePlugin>jacoco</sonar.core.codeCoveragePlugin>
diff --git a/tests/ECPQ7Tests/pom.xml b/tests/ECPQ7Tests/pom.xml
index eb9b7f1..ebde943 100644
--- a/tests/ECPQ7Tests/pom.xml
+++ b/tests/ECPQ7Tests/pom.xml
@@ -12,7 +12,7 @@
<rcptt-maven-version>2.5.2</rcptt-maven-version>
<build_job>ecp-develop-full</build_job>
<currentBuild>https://hudson.eclipse.org/ecp/job/${build_job}/lastSuccessfulBuild/artifact/releng/</currentBuild>
- <jacoco-version>0.8.5</jacoco-version>
+ <jacoco-version>0.8.10</jacoco-version>
</properties>
<pluginRepositories>